Each design of breast prosthesis will fit differently depending upon the design of bra you choose. Therefore, it is essential to discover bra size and take your own measurements so you can find a bra and prosthesis combo that works well for you! Utilizing a soft tape step, procedure around your chest simply under the pectoral muscles where the natural breast tissue joins the body.
Make sure to keep the measuring tape level with the flooring when placing it around your body. Take a snug measurement. realistic breast forms. This number will be used to figure your bra band size. This part looks like it must be simple, but it is a little complicated by the bra industry itself! Logic would say that your bra band size ought to equal your under-bust measurement.
Lots of bra business use a sizing system such that a person measuring 36 inches under-bust would use a 40 bra band (36 plus 4). Transform is a company that utilizes the "plus 4" system, so if you are purchasing a Transform See-Thru Bra from our site, utilize your measurement plus 4 to find your band size because bra. The "plus 4" guideline described above for band sizing is quite common in the industry, however in the last few years it has actually fallen out of favor with some more recent bra companies. There are a number of sellers who equip a much greater series of band and cup options, particularly for hard-to-fit sizes.
Confused? Don't fret! The world of bra fitting is as much an art as a science. There are three crucial things to bear in mind from all this. First: always understand your real under-bust measurement! 2nd: when purchasing a bra, ask if the design you are choosing uses a "plus 4" band sizing, or a real measurement. If it is a decent shop, they ought to have the ability to help fit you based on their understanding of the products. And 3rd: whenever you can, try out a bra for fit, and know the return policy if you are buying bras online. You may find a 36 band size works excellent in one brand, but that you wear a 38 in another company's bra.
Another note on bra bands: they just can be found in even numbers. So, if you measure 35 inches, assemble to 36 as your beginning point for under-bust measurement. Your band size number stays the exact same, no matter the size of your breasts. And with breast kinds, you get to pick your cup size, or perhaps experiment with different cup sizes by wearing various sized types! The size of the cups on a bra is suggested by a letter, beginning with A and proceeding up the alphabet. Cup size A is smaller sized than B, B is smaller sized than C, C is smaller sized than D, and so on - the breast form store.
DD is larger than D, and DDD is bigger than DD. The odd exception to this system is AA, which is smaller sized than A! Rather than being a repaired size or volume, cup size is relative to your band size - silicone breast form. That is, a "B" cup on an extremely little individual is in fact smaller sized than a "B" cup on a huge person. The "B" refers to how far the breast tissue jobs far from the body, not how big the actual cup is! When choosing your cup size, consider your height, weight, and figure. The form sizes suggested here ought to offer you shallow-to-average cup fit. If you would like a fuller cup fit, try the form size simply above.
Spread the bra out on a flat surface with the within the bra facing you. 2. Hold the kind by the edges with a flat hand so that the nipple is dealing with down. 3. Spread the elastic on the cup and slide the type in so that the nipple faces outward. 4. Adjust the form so it settles into the bottom of the cup. 5. Hold the bra up with the type inside the pocket to ensure it looks correct. 6. Take care not to pierce the kind or fold it. Transform silicone types are very resilient, but the polyurethane skin can be punctured.
Put your bra on as you generally would, securing the bra band comfortably. 2. Extend the bra strap on one side - pals breast forms. 3. Pull the cup away from the chest wall. 4. Insert the type from the inside top of the cup. Turn the kind in the direction that finest fills the bra cup and looks the most natural. Repeat on the other side. 5. After types remain in place, change the straps on each side. 6. Take a look at the fit. Both sides should match and the bra cups must cover the prosthesis totally. The prosthesis leading tapers need to prevent clothes from sinking in.
The straps should not cut into the shoulders. 7. silicone breast prosthesis. If the types are too huge, too small, or do not fill where they need to fill, try another design or size of form. Always take care not to pierce the form or fold it when handling and fitting. Silicone forms are extremely resilient, but the polyurethane skin on some forms can be punctured by sharp nails or misuse. Never sleep in your breast kinds unless the manufacturer suggests it is safe to do soyour body weight could trigger the forms to rupture.

American Breast Care has established a variety of breast kinds to suit the different preferences and activities of their clients. Suitable for using within ABC leisure bras or while sleeping, extremely lightweight foam breast forms are built from hypoallergenic fiberfill covered in soft material that is gentle on the skin.
ABC silicone breast forms been available in a variety of models including the ABC Silicone Air which is 45% lighter than basic silicone breast forms thanks to the specifically aerated silicone lessening pressure on the chest wall and shoulders. Another style of silicone kind is the ABC My Kind, which is built from a lightweight silicone shell filled with hypoallergenic fiberfill. These types are adjustable at the back so you can develop a custom fit. Unlike basic silicone breast forms, ABC swim kinds are specially designed for use in the water. A lot of designs are usually built from ultra-lightweight aerated silicone for buoyancy and comfort (breast prosthesis suppliers near me).
American Breast Care breast types can be found in a variety of shapes and sizes to suit the unique bodies of mastectomy clients. To discover the very best suitable for your body type, visit a certified fitter for a professional fitting. breast form. Oval breast types are perfect for ladies with a complete cup profile with equal volume both above and below the nipple. These kinds are in proportion and can be endured both the left and ideal sides of the body. Triangular forms are another balanced design of breast kind; nevertheless, this shape is best matched to females with a wide chest wall and with a typical to shallow cup profile.
Asymmetrical breast kinds are best suited to ladies who have actually gone through comprehensive surgery as this style features a lengthened tailpiece that contours around the chest and under the arms or high up onto the chest wall depending on where you most need added volume. They are designed for use on either the left or ideal side. Shapers are created to include volume and shape to the remaining breast tissue after a partial mastectomy or lumpectomy. These forms are much smaller sized than full breast kinds but can still fit easily inside stolen mastectomy bras without shifting.
